We have created a web-based Aircraft Maintenance Technician’s Logbook (AMTL) that allows students, mechanics, and engineers to log the maintenance tasks that they carry out.
Whether this is for logging maintenance tasks to prove experience when applying for a license or for demonstrating competency when applying for an aircraft type approval.
AMTL captures the experience and competence of all individuals using it. Additionally, we have designed it to be used by academies and colleges who benefit by being able to track their student’s competence, completion of practical tasks and theoretical study. AMTL also has a range of features for Part 145 organisations and Recruitment Agencies.
